Fernwood is a new village located just 3 miles from Newark. Village amenities include the Chuter Ede Primary School (Fernwood Annexe) which has an outstanding OFSTED. Additionally, there are secondary schools nearby including the Suthers School and Newark Academy both having good OFSTED reports. Local shops in Fernwood include a Onestop convenience store, with additional amenities including an Indian takeaway, the Brews Brothers pub and kitchen, The Tawny Owl pub/restaurant, Fernwood village hall and the Fernwood day nursery providing local childcare. There are playing fields which include tennis courts. Nearby Balderton has additional amenities including Sainsbury's and Lidl supermarkets, a Tesco Express store, pharmacy, library and medical centre. There are nearby access points to the A1 and A46 dual carriageways. The southern link road, under construction, will shortly connect the A1 via Balderton and Fernwood to the A46 and is currently scheduled for completion during 2025. Train services are available from Newark Northgate railway station connecting to London kings cross with journey times in just over 75 minutes.
